I'm trying to set up Thunderbird to send e-mail using my new FIOS/Yahoo e-mail address which is xxxxx@verizon.net. The ISP on the computer from which I am trying to send is Verizon FIOS. I can receive e-mails in Thunderbird but cannot send.
I have tried both using SMTS outgoing.verizon.net and outgoing.yahoo.verizon.net. For incoming I had to use incoming.yahoo.verizon.net and it works.
I've tried using Port 25 and Port 587.
I've input my username both with and without the @verizon.net
For "Secure Connection" I've tried all choices: No, TLS, if available, TLS and SSL.
Whenever I try to send an e-mail it usually asks for my password twice and after inputting it the second time I get a version of this message:
The message could not be sent because connecting to SMTP server outgoing.verizon.net failed. The server may be unavailable or is refusing SMTP connections. Please verify that your SMTP server setting is correct and try again, or else contact your network administrator.
